I don't understand this question. First of all, that's a lot of scripts. I suspect you could combine many of them.

Second, what do you mean by "different variable name than field[Value].value"? field[Value].value isn't a variable, it's a number. The variable is Rit. Variables are only used within the script they are created within. For example, script #8 knows nothing about the variable Rit in script #2.

Looking at script #8, I don't see where Rit is used to refer to two different numbers. Perhaps your confusion is using "Rit" in multiple scripts? It's ok to do that, but you can also change the name of the variable from script to script and get the same outcome.

If you need to have field[Value].value set to two different numbers at different times, I'd recommend using field[Value2].value as the second number, but I'm not sure that's what you're looking for.
